As the PSN mid-year sales event races toward its conclusion on July 2, players are buzzing about incredible offers. With prices slashed on popular titles, gamers are seizing the chance to stock their libraries.

Hot Picks and Recommendations

Many people have taken to forums to share their favorites. One standout is Pentiment, available for only ten bucks. Gamers who appreciated Disco Elysium, Outer Wilds, or Citizen Sleeper are particularly excited. A user remarked, "If youโ€™ve enjoyed these titles, this is a must-try!"

Combat Action shines through as another popular pick, with several mentions of the new game Wukong, capturing attention. On the boards, one thrilled commenter cheered, "Wu-tang! I mean Wukong! Wooohooo!"

Community Buzz and Sentiment

The overall sentiment seems positive as players reflect on these deals. Enthusiasts highlight the potential of Pentiment despite its steep learning curve. Comments uplift the rewarding payoff that comes as players immerse themselves deeper in its story.

"High barrier of entry, but gets more rewarding and absorbing as you play," said one enthusiastic player, echoing what many feel about the game.
